There was only a 5-year span (2007-2011) in which we got regular and super #Treasure Hunts (TH/$TH) of the same casting. This began when Hot Wheels went to the 2-tier TH system in 2007 and ended in 2012 when super Treasure Hunts became hidden in the various segment […]
The #RLC #sELECTIONs series is a rather unique concept in the diecast world. In 2004, the idea was launched (to coincide with the United States’ Presidential Election that year) to have the collectors “design” a series of Red Line Club vehicles. Collectors were able to vote for a casting (from […]

Quick! Get into the #Deora II and lets take a trip back to the early days of the Red Line Club (RLC) over at HotWheelsCollectors.com (HWC). HWC was launched on July 29, 2001 by Mattel/Hot Wheels as a place to have collectors share everything Hot Wheels and as a place […]
